Top Bars in Surfers Paradise 

 

The Island Rooftop 

Sitting above the boutique hotel The Island, The Island Rooftop is the Gold Coast’s biggest rooftop bar. The sprawling alfresco brings an air of effortless cool, attracting everyone from recently graduated party goers to parents on the loose and everyone in between. The retro-style cocktail bar serves up all the crowd-favourites and has ample seating, tables, nooks and benchtops for you to crowd around with your mates. 

While things don’t cool down too much on the Gold Coast during winter, these guys have outdoor heaters installed to take the edge off any evening temperatures. But it’s the Sunday sessions that will really heat up your experience. Cocktails, cheap bites and DJ beats anyone? 

Where: 3218 Surfers Paradise Boulevard, Surfers Paradise

 

BOBs Beer

Any Gold Coast visitor or traveller worth their salt will know about BOBs Beer. And even if you haven’t heard it, you’re sure to notice the striking, three-storey white-washed brewpub that commands the bustling corner of Elkhorn and Orchid Avenue. The brains behind this joint it ex-Red Duck, Clifton Hill and Bad Shepard brewer Ryan Fullerton, so you know you’re onto a good thing here! 

If you love a craft beer – this is the place for you. All of BOBs in-house craft beers are lovingly brewed by the team. With a focus on quality, they’re committed to using only the very best locally sourced ingredients. It’s not just the drinks of this calibre either! Their food is absolutely top notch, so you’ll want to order a few rounds of lotus root chippies to go with all that beer. 

Where: 10/2 Elkhorn Ave, Surfers Paradise 

 

Hyde Paradiso 

For anyone seeking a chilled venue for your Sunday session, you’ll want to head on down to Hyde Paradiso. Here, long lunches lead into dinner with live DJs to set the tone. It’s like a European summer escape, right here on the shore of Surfers Paradise. In fact, the venue is actually part of a famous hospitality group in the US, so you know you’re in good hands. 

Hyde Paradiso is nestled away on the second level of Peppers Soul and overlooking the ocean. As you enjoy the incredible view of golden sands and glistening blue waters, you can sip your way through the jam-packed cocktail menu and nibble on the array of bar food up for grabs. 

Where: Peppers Soul, 8 Esplanade, Surfers Paradise 

 

Duke’s Parlour

The Duke is the father of modern surfing. As one of the first people to promote wave riding in Australia, there’s no better place to honour his legacy than right in the heart of Surfers Paradise. Sitting underneath The Island boutique hotel, this moody bar oozes effortless cool right from the very first moment. 

Walk in and take your pick from the leather chesterfield couches, shoot your best shot in pool or order one of the house cocktails made from the extensive list of gin, whiskey and tequila. Did we mention they serve woodfired pizza and host live music on weekends? Yep, it really doesn’t get much better than this. 

Where: 6 Beach Road, Surfers Paradise

 

Surfers Paradise Beer Garden

What’s a night out on the Gold Coast without a stop at the iconic Surfers Paradise Beer Garden? After years in its prime location on the bustling Cavill Avenue, this joint has gone on to become quite the institution. Whether you’re a local frequently the bar every weekend or a traveller making the most of your time away, you’ll never be able to get enough. 

During the day, the retractable roof invites the gorgeous sunshine and salty breezes inside, where the trendy white and wood panelling, nautical features and picnic tables welcome crowds of all ages and demographics. Once the sun starts to set and the festoon lights begin to twinkle, you’ll see this Surfers Paradise rooftop bar truly come alive. Order yourself a refreshing beverage and settle into a sinkable couch on the wraparound deck for the best view of palm trees and Cavill Avenue. In between the people watching, the epic on-tap beers and the incredible bar food menu, you’ll quickly come to learn why people love Surfers Paradise Beer Garden so much.
